14 procédures ai security issues de Anthropic-Cybersecurity-Skills, chargées par les agents CyberForge. Chaque skill est un fichier lisible, versionné, retirable.
| Skill | Ce qu'il fait |
|---|---|
| assessing vector and embedding weaknesses | Test vector stores for embedding inversion, cross-tenant leakage, and poisoning. |
| auditing mcp servers for tool poisoning | Scan Model Context Protocol servers and tool metadata for poisoning, SSRF, and unauthenticated exposure. |
| continuous llm red teaming with promptfoo | Wire Promptfoo and DeepTeam into CI/CD for automated regression red-teaming of LLM apps against OWASP LLM Top 10 and OWASP Agentic presets, failing the build when jailbreak or injection vulnerabilities regress. |
| defending llms with guardrails | Deploy Llama Guard, NeMo Guardrails, and LLM Guard input/output scanners as runtime defenses. |
| detecting ai model prompt injection attacks | Detects prompt injection attacks targeting LLM-based applications using a multi-layered defense combining regex pattern matching for known attack signatures, heuristic scoring for structural anomalies, and transformer-based classification with DeBERTa models. |
| detecting data and model poisoning | Identify poisoned training data and backdoored models across the ML pipeline. |
| detecting indirect prompt injection | Detect and defend against prompt injection hidden in documents, web pages, and images consumed by an agent. |
| detecting model extraction attacks | Detect model stealing, model inversion, and membership inference performed through inference-API abuse by monitoring query patterns, applying output perturbation, and red-teaming your own model's extractability. |
| implementing llm guardrails for security | Implements input and output validation guardrails for LLM-powered applications to prevent prompt injection, data leakage, toxic content generation, and hallucinated outputs. Builds a security validation pipeline using NVIDIA NeMo Guardrails Colang definitions, |
| orchestrating llm attacks with pyrit | Build multi-turn, Crescendo, and Tree-of-Attacks-with-Pruning (TAP) automated attack chains against conversational LLM agents using Microsoft PyRIT, with adversarial chat and scorer feedback loops. |
| red teaming llms with garak | Run NVIDIA garak probe suites against an LLM endpoint to test for jailbreaks, prompt injection, data leakage, and toxic generation, then interpret the hit-rate report for triage and reporting. |
| securing agentic ai tool invocation | Apply least-privilege tool allowlisting, identity binding, and human-in-the-loop controls for agent tool calls. |
| testing for system prompt leakage | Extract and defend system prompts plus embedded secrets and routing logic. |
| testing prompt injection in rag pipelines | Probe RAG applications for prompt injection via poisoned retrieved context and embedding manipulation. |
